Blazers Drop Two To Alvernia

FORT MYERS, Fla. – The Elms College baseball team dropped two games to Alvernia at the Gene Cusic Collegiate Classic on Thursday. The Blazers fell 10-2 in the early game and 7-2 in the afternoon.

Elms drops to 0-5 on the season after the two losses while Alvernia improves to 2-2 on the season. The Blazers continue action on Monday with a single game against the US Merchant Marine Academy at 3:00 p.m.

GAME 1 – Alvernia 10, Elms 2
Alvernia jumped out to an early 4-0 lead and never looked back in the early game on Sunday. The Golden Wolves took advantage of three Blazer errors in the first inning to plate four runs. Alvernia added three more in the fifth, two in the sixth and another in the seventh before Elms broke through with two in the bottom of the seventh.

Thomas Slane went 2-for-3 for Elms and Nathan Ayala went 1-for-3 with two RBIs. Matt Plasse pitched six innings and struck out three batters. Six of Alvernia's nine runs under his watch were earned. Michael Luciano pitched the final inning and struck out one while giving up one run.

GAME 2 – Alvernia 7, Elms 2
A grand slam from Alvernia's Dillon Dunne was too much for the Blazers to overcome in the second half of the double-header, as Elms fell 7-2.

The Blazers took an early 1-0 lead with a run in the top of the first inning, and held that advantage until Dunne went yard in the fourth. The Golden Wolves added a run in the fifth and two in the sixth before Elms got one back in the seventh.

Ben Ross went 2-for-4 in the leadoff slot for the Blazers in the game, while Slane picked up another RBI while going 1-for-3 at the plate.
